Sequoia National Park in central California is around a 3.5-hour drive from Los Angeles. The park comprises over 631 square miles, and it is home to the largest trees worldwide, mountain peaks, and peaceful canyons. Fresno is the closest major city and is located about an hour and twenty minutes from Sequoia when entering through the Ash Mountain Entrance near the town of Three Rivers. Head South on CA-99 and take exit 97 to CA-198 E. Continue on CA-198 E into the park.

President Benjamin Harrison established Sequoia National Park in 1890 to protect the giant sequoia trees from logging. Kings Canyon National Park came along in 1940, with support from President Franklin D. Roosevelt. chip gnssWebb19 juli 2024 · A place to be one with nature.
